Steering fails to return to center…

Based on our experience, 99% of the time the problem is with the servo saver. The servo saver mechanism is heavy, and the C ring can fail eventually.

 

To solve the problem, the easiest thing to do is to not use a servo saver. If the car does not crash heavily, the chance of damage is minimal. And servo is something pretty cheap nowadays…
